GNU/Linux >> Linux Esercitazione >  >> Linux

Linux ottiene l'offset UTC dai fusi orari correnti (o altri) in una determinata data e ora

Puoi usare il date comando. Impostare il fuso orario e quindi specificare la data e l'ora. Il comando restituirà quell'ora con -03 o -04, quindi saprai se l'ora legale era in vigore.

Ad esempio, per Cile/Continental:

Prima che l'ora legale cambi quest'anno:

$ TZ=Chile/Continental date --date='2020-04-03 11:00 +00'
Fri Apr  3 11:00:00 -03 2020

Dopo la modifica dell'ora legale quest'anno:

$ TZ=Chile/Continental date --date='2020-04-06 11:00 +00'
Mon Apr  6 11:00:00 -04 2020

Per annullare ciò, basta impostare TZ su UTC e modificare l'offset:

$ TZ=UTC date --date='2020-04-03 11:00 -04'

Linux
  1. 7 Esempi di comandi della data di Linux per visualizzare e impostare la data e l'ora del sistema

  2. Formatta data e ora per lo script o la variabile della shell Linux

  3. Ottieni l'ora corrente in secondi da Epoch su Linux, Bash

  4. Come posso ottenere la data e l'ora correnti nel terminale e impostare un comando personalizzato nel terminale per questo?

  5. Cronologia dei comandi di Linux con data e ora

Come ottenere la data e l'ora correnti in JavaScript

Come trovare la data e l'ora esatte di installazione del tuo sistema operativo Linux

Come trovare la data e l'ora di installazione del sistema operativo Linux

Come impostare data e ora su Linux

Gestione efficace dei fusi orari di Linux (esercitazione dettagliata)

Come modificare data, ora e fuso orario in Linux Mint 20